Lie
Do not assert with your mouth what your heart denies.
- Yin Chih Wen
There are three types of lies -- lies, damned lies, and statistics.
- Benjamin Disraeli
Every lie is two lies — the lie we tell others and the lie we tell ourselves to justify it.
- Robert Brault
Half of the people lie with their lips; the other half with their tears.
- Nassim Nicholas Taleb
It is hard to believe that a man is telling the truth when you know that you would lie if you were in his place.
- H. L. Mencken
A lie will easily get you out of a scrape, and yet, strangely and beautifully, rapture possesses you when you have taken the scrape and left out the lie.
- Charles Edward Montague
Great liars are also Great magicians.
- Adolf Hitler
I am a lie who always speaks the truth.
- Jean Cocteau
The only thing worse than a liar is a liar that's also a hypocrite!
- Tennessee Williams
We tell lies when we are afraid... afraid of what we don't know, afraid of what others will think, afraid of what will be found out about us. But every time we tell a lie, the thing that we fear grows stronger.
- Robert Paul “Tad” Williams
